      06:30 - Pick up from Jerusalem 08:30 - Cross the border into Jordan 10:00 - Start your explorations with a short tour of Jerash. Jerash was part of the Graeco-Roman Decapolis, the league of ten cities bound by strong political, social and commercial interests. It's one of the best preserved Roman towns outside Italy 12:00 - Continue to tour in the city of Amman - Jordan's sprawling capital city. Walking in Amman visit the Citadel, the Roman ruins, and the Roman theater in the most active center of the city, King Abdullah Mosque (outside visit) 17:00 - After a full day of exploring the sites, enjoy a relaxing evening in your hotel and get ready for tomorrowโ€™s adventure Overnight in Amman

      08:00 - start your day at Mount Nebo - the place where Moses is buried. Enjoy the wonderful view up from the mountain seeing the Jordan Valley, the Dead Sea, and Jericho in the other bank of the Jordan River 10:00 - Drive to visit Madaba, best known for its Byzantine and Umayyad mosaics, especially a large Byzantine-era mosaic map of The Holy Land. Visit Madaba's most spectacular churches around the world: ST. George church where you will find the Mosaic Map of Jerusalem painted on the floor of the church 12:00 - Drive towards Wadi Rum, and enjoy a jeep tour with the unique views of the Wadi 18:00 - Arrive at the Bedouin campsite in Wadi Rum and enjoy an authentic dinner in the desert setting 20:00 - Overnight in Wadi Rum (upgrades possible) Optional stargazing experience in the desert and sunset camel ride
